hematopoietic system
• increased in the spleen in mice treated with poly (I:C)
• ineffective erythropoiesis in bone marrow and spleen in mice treated with poly (I:C)
• development of anemia in mice treated with poly (I:C)
• 5 fold increase in splenic erythroid progenitor cells in mice treated with poly (I:C)
• 10 fold increase in primitive erythroid progenitor cells in bone marrow
• increased number of non-viable cells in both spleen and bone marrow
• 2 fold increase in bone marrow in mice treated with poly (I:C)
• decreased red blood cell number in mice treated with poly (I:C)
• 50% decrease in mature red blood cell numbers in bone marrow
